Colombian government shows puppet status with extraditions to U.S.

BOGOTA, Colombia — In a move that reconfirms its role as a puppet regime for U.S. interests, the government of Colombia extradited a woman accused of having a relationship with the Revolutionary Armed Forces of Colombia, or the FARC, to the U.S. to be put on trial.

Seemingly unable to make a move without U.S. consent, the Colombian government has been confirmed to have extradited at least 152 Colombians to the U.S. over the past year alone.

Nancy Conde Rubio is accused of having supported FARC militants during the period that three American mercenaries, whose plane crashed while on some type of surveillance mission inside FARC territory, were captured by the FARC.
